Meaning and Origin
Bogumila, a name of Polish and Slavic origin, carries a rich history and profound meaning. Derived from the Slavic elements "bog," signifying God, and "mila," meaning gracious, Bogumila essentially translates to "God's grace." This connection to the divine imbues the name with a sense of spirituality and benevolence. As the female counterpart of Bogumil, it shares a similar meaning and cultural significance.

Variation and Similar Names
Bogumila has several variations and similar-sounding names. "Bogumiła" is a Polish variation, with a subtle difference in spelling but with the same pronunciation and meaning. Other similar names include "Bohumila," "Bogumir," and "Bogumił."
